In a particular type of cat, coat color follows the dominant/recessive pattern of inheritance. The allele for a brown coat (B) i

s dominant to the allele for a white coat (b).
A cross between two white-coated cats would result in what?

Answer: All the offsprings will be white coated.

Explanation: From the information given, white coat gene (b) is recessive, therefore for it to manifest outwardly, the gene must be present in a homozygous state. Therefore, the genotype of a white coated is bb. A cross between two white coated cats bb x bb will result in all the offsprings having a genotype of bb and manifest phenotypically as white coated cats.

What is the difference between a hot-water system and a steam-heating system?
Nonamiya [84]

Steam radiators and hot water radiators are very similar, so much so that in many cases they are interchangeable. Many homes have been converted from steam to hot water heating systems (and vice versa) without having to change the actual radiators.

The most obvious difference between the two is that a hot water radiator is always equipped with two connections: hot water goes into the radiator on one side, and the cooled water leaves on the other. Steam radiators can have either one or two connectors: hot steam can enter on one side, and condensed water can leave either through the same pipe or through a pipe on the other side.

While it is certainly best to use a steam radiator for steam and a hot water radiator for water, in some cases a switch between the two will require only a few simple operations.
